NIC in Lumbini

NIC Asia Bank formally inaugurated four new branches in Nawalparasi and three in Rupandehi districts on 11 February. The Bank currently has 170 branches, 168 ATM counters and 4 extension counters all over Nepal.

Cathay connection

Cathay Dragon has added Jinan, the capital of China’s Shandong province as its 28th destination in the mainland. The airline will start the four-times-weekly service from Hong Kong to Jinan, also known as the city of springs, from 26 March onwards.

Capitals merge

NIBL Capital Markets and Ace Capital merged this week to operate jointly under the brand name ‘NIBL Ace Capital’. The consolidated entity with a paid up capital of Rs 270 million will cater to more than 142,000 DEMAT accounts and provide RTA/RTS services for 38 companies and over 1,000,000 shareholders.
